Seacrest Park Cove 1 is a popular dive site located in Washington, known for its diverse marine life and easy access from the shore. The site features rocky structures and sandy bottoms, providing a habitat for various species.
Diving at Seacrest Park Cove 1 typically involves exploring the rocky outcrops and kelp forests. Divers can expect to see a variety of fish, invertebrates, and possibly some larger marine animals. The site is suitable for divers of all levels, with easy entry and exit points.
